文件存储NAS:是面向阿里云ECS实例、E-HPC、容器服务等计算节点的文件存储服务,是一种可共享访问、弹性扩展、高可靠以及高性能的分布式文件系统。 对象存储OSS:是一款海量、安全、低成本、高可靠的云存储服务,可提供99.9999999999%(12个9)的数据持久性,99.995%的数据可用性。多种存储类型供选择,全面优化存储成本。 NAS应用场景:主要应用于科学计算、容器数据持久化和企业在线生产应用的数据存储。如:AI计算、基因计算、药物计算、容器共享PV、日志数据持久化、CI/CD平台、云桌面数据文件共享等。 OSS应用场景:主要应用于基于对象API开发的互联网应用程序的数据存储。如:互联网业务的音视频存储、数据湖、云相册。 当然还有访问模式、最低时延、单实例最大吞吐、数据存储方式、协议等的区别,可以参考官方文档:https://help.aliyun.com/document_detail/140812.html,里面写的很详细
文件存储NAS和对象存储OSS区别对比 什么是对象存储OSS?什么是文件存储NAS?对象存储OSS不同于目录树,OSS采用扁平文件存储形式;而文件存储NAS可以直接像访问本地文件系统一样访问文件存储NAS:
阿里云对象存储OSS不依赖云服务器,使用RESTful API 可以在互联网任何位置存储和访问,容量和处理能力弹性扩展。对象存储OSS常用于网站搭建、动静资源分离、CDN加速等业务场景。对象存储是一个海量、高可用、安全及低成本的存储方式。 阿里云文件存储NAS是可共享访问的弹性扩展高性能云原生分布式文件系统,类似NFS挂载共享文件夹,文件存储NAS适用于企业部门间文件共享、广电非线编、高性能计算、Docker等业务场景。 从OSS和NAS底层技术、使用方式、是否依赖云服务器、容量大小、集群访问、存储内容及价格成本等方面来对比下对象存储OSS和文件存储NAS的区别及选择:
是否依赖云服务器
阿里云文件存储NAS需要搭配云服务器一起使用,而对象存储OSS可以搭配云服务器也可以单独使用。
使用方式对比
阿里云对象存储OSS可以使用阿里丰富的API,提供PHP、Python和Java等多种语言的SDK;OSS不依赖云服务器使用也可以用于静态网站托管;而文件存储NAS像访问磁盘一样不需要改任何程序,一般高IO带宽或高IOPS应用场景不建议使用NAS作为存储介质。
使用场景区别
阿里云对象存储OSS适用于Web网站图片存储,例如阿里云百科制作的静态网站托管就是使用的OSS,头条网站/应用动静分离也是使用的阿里云对象存储OSS,用户可以像文件夹一样管理您网站上的图片,脚本,视频等静态资源,通过BGP网络或者CDN加速的方式,提供用户就近访问,有效降低云服务器负载,提升用户体验。另外对象存储OSS还支持图片处理、媒体转码等增值服务,像新浪微博、迅雷的等都有在使用阿里云的对象存储OSS服务。
阿里云文件存储NAS可以理解为NFS挂载共享文件夹,适用于企业部门间文件共享,可用于Devops开发测试环境共享代码程序等使用场景。流利说依托阿里云NAS的高性能、高可靠、弹性扩展能力和原生POSIX接口支持,构建容器环境下的模型训练系统;百世快递采用文件存储NAS构建了一套能快速分发、低成本、高弹性的数据解决方案。阿里云文件存储NAS适用于容器、大数据分析、Web服务和内容管理、应用程序开发和测试、媒体和娱乐工作流程、数据库备份等场景。
存储容量及大小区别
OSS和NAS的存储内容基本类似,面向的都是图片、文档等静态文件的存储;对于零散的数据(如文本文件、办公文档、图片、视频及音频等)且有多区域或多用户共享或权限要求严格的需求可以使用NAS作为存储介质,且不影响整体交易类数据;关于存储容量大小方面,OSS单个bucket大小无限制;NAS单个文件系统最大1PB;
可以使用阿里云测速工具aliyunping.com测试一下本地到阿里云服务器各个地域节点的Ping值网络延迟。
使用方式区别
OSS使用阿里丰富的API,提供PHP、Python和Java等多种语言的SDK;而NAS像访问磁盘一样不需要改任何程序,一般高IO带宽或高IOPS应用场景不建议使用NAS作为存储介质。
存储性能对比
系统组之前完成过OSS NAS性能测试,OSS性能不如NAS,可以通过断点续传上传文件/断点续传下载等方式提升性能;
集群访问
NAS文档中提到NFS协议本身并没有提供Atomic Append语义的支持,因此可能会出现写覆盖、交叉、串行等异常现象;OSS的无此类问题,即集群文件共享功能。
1、技术:OSS是对象存储;NAS是传统的NFS,即挂载共享文件夹;
2、使用方式:OSS使用阿里丰富的API,提供了PHP,Python,Java等多种语言的SDK;而NAS像访问磁盘一样不需要改任何程序,一般高IO带宽或高IOPS应用场景不建议使用NAS作为存储介质;
3、存储内容:OSS和NAS的存储内容基本类似,面向的都是图片、文档等静态文件的存储;对于零散的数据(如文本文件、办公文档、图片、视频、音频等)且有多区域或多用户共享或权限要求严格的需求可以使用NAS作为存储介质,且不影响整体交易类数据;
4、容量:OSS单个bucket大小无限制;NAS单个文件系统最大1PB;
5、性能:系统组之前完成过OSS NAS性能测试,OSS性能不如NAS,可以通过断点续传上传文件/断点续传下载等方式提升性能。
6、集群访问:NAS文档中提到NFS 协议本身并没有提供Atomic Append语义的支持,因此可能会出现写覆盖、交叉、串行等异常现象;OSS的无此类问题,即集群文件共享功能。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。